    ●Task  Convincing a friend
    Skills building 1: listening for the sequence of events
    While listening to a story, or to someone recounting their experience, it is important to note the sequence or order of events. Sometimes, people begin by discussing the current situation and then go back to discuss events in the past, or sometimes, people will start their story at the beginning and then go forward. In this part, you will learn how to notice the sequence of events while you are listening to a story or someone recounting your experiences. Pay attention to some phrases that will help you understand when things happened and in what order. Some examples:
    in the beginning        then         before         originally
    after                  eventually    after that      when    in the end
    Exercise: listen to the passage and write down the words or phrases that are used to show when something happened and in what order.
    Last year, my sister went to study in Germany as an exchange student. She stayed there for one year. When she returned, she said that that she had had a very enjoyable time there. In the beginning, she found it was a bit difficult for her to understand what the teachers said in class, especially in Maths and Science classes because she could not understand some special words or phrases used in these two subjects. Therefore, before a Maths and Science class, she tried to preview what would be taught in the class. Then she got on quite well with her studies. Now, she has come back from Germany and has learnt a lot about Maths, Science and , of course, the German language.
    Step 1: finding information about a returnee
    1. You will listen to a TV show and a conversation, and finish some exercises related to them, and then read a newspaper article. Then can get some information about why more and more overseas Chinese return to China after they have been studying and working abroad.
    Tapescript:
    Host:    The topic of 'brain drain' has been in the news recently, and what we're discussing today is the recent reversal of this trend. Specially, we're talking about people who were educated abroad, and might even have worked abroad, but are now returning to China to live and work. I'd like to welcome Mr Zhu Mr Zhu, who will tell us about his experience abroad.
    Zhu Lin:  Thank you for having me here today. When I graduated form university, I looked around at all the other recent graduates who also wanted jobs, and I thought, 'What makes me special or better than they are?' I realized that to get a really good job, I'd need more training. At that time, many of the best places to get certain advanced degrees were outside of China. I did some research and found a PhD course in the UK that was perfect for me. In the end, I lived in the UK for five years. After I completed my degree, I was offered a job by a top company in London. I had thought about coming home to China, but eventually felt that the position was too good to turn down. I also thought that if I worked for a few years in a Western country and learnt how they do things, I could bring that knowledge back to China and become a more valuable employee.
    Host:  Why did you decide to come back?
    Zhu Lin: By then, many international companies had opened offices in China and I felt that there were new opportunities. I started contacting companies in Shanghai and Beijing to find work before I left London. I set up interviews and found a new job only a few weeks after returning. Do you know what the funniest thing of all is?
    Host: No. What?
    Zhu Lin: I stayed abroad because I thought I'd have better opportunities and be able to save more money, but my job here is actually much better than the one I had in London!
    Host: We have to take a break now, and when we come back, we'll take phone calls from viewers at home.

    3. Read the instructions in Part B. You should guess what reasons Mr Zhu will talk about and try to fill in the blanks.
    Tapescript:
    Zhu Lin:   Hello?
    Student:   Hello! Is that Zhu Lin?
    Zhu Lin:  Yes, speaking.
    Student:   oh, hello! I'm a student and I have a question. Well, a friend of mine is studying in the UK now and is worried about returning to China after her studies. She's worried there are no job opportunities for her here. Do you have any advice for her?
    Zhu Lin: Well, as I said earlier, in the beginning, I thought there were more opportunities for me abroad. However, when I started doing some research, I realized that there were just as many opportunities in China now.
    Student:  Do you think she will find a good job here?
    Zhu Lin: Yes, I think so. Employers, especially big international companies, like to hire people who have lived or studied abroad.
    Student: Why?
    Zhu Lin: Well, first of all, because your friend has lived and studied in an English-speaking country for some time, her English must be very good. With more and more international companies opening offices in China, it's more important than ever that employees are able to communicate with English-speaking customers. She also has first-hand experience of living in another culture and is more likely to understand people from that culture if she has to deal with them in China. Finally, she may also know how business is done in another country and so may be very valuable to any company in China that is trying to sell something there.
